The easiest way to freeze ginger is whole, skin and all. Purchase fresh ginger roots and store them whole in a plastic freezer bag. Squeeze out any excess air. They’ll keep up to one year this way. The skin works to preserve the flesh for longer. To use, simply cut off a chunk or grate as needed.
WebWhen storing ginger root in the fridge, wrap the unpeeled root inside a paper towel and then place it inside a plastic bag. Yes, you can store unpeeled ginger at room temperature or in the refrigerator in an airtight zip-top bag or container and tuck it in the crisper drawer; if stored properly, fresh ginger can last for weeks. If you have already peeled the ginger, it must be stored in the fridge to prevent oxidation. WebApr 12, 2024 · Try ginger root. WebNov 4, 2024 · How To Store Unpeeled uncut ginger can be stored at room temperature for a few days or in the fridge for up to three weeks. For longer-term storage, ginger is very freezer-friendly for around 6 months. Once peeled, chopped, or grated, store the ginger in the fridge in an airtight container for only a day.
